
President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y arrives in Saudi Arabia to address the Arab League summit. The Ukrainian delegation includes the leader of the Crimean Tatar people Mustafa Dzhemilev.
The President of Ukraine said that he would meet with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man Al Saud and hold other bilateral talks: “Our priorities are the return of all political prisoners of Crimea and the temporarily occupied territories, the return of all prisoners and illegally deported persons, the presentation of our peace formula, the implementation of which should involve as many states as possible, and the guarantee of energy security next winter.”
Volodymyr Zelenskyy added that he has another priority – the protection of the Muslim community of Ukraine: “Crimea was the first to suffer from the Russian occupation, and most of those who are being repressed in the occupied Crimea are Muslims.”
